The washer has a drain motor in line with the outlet pipe. The motor must turn when in outlet mode. This motor has an impeler that turns at high speed to pump out water in the outlet mode. The motor could be faulty or the lelectrical push on connectors to the motor loose. One can remove the motor and coonect it directly to the mains voltage for a few seconds to check if it spins (also make sure that nothing is blocking the impeler from spinning).
